Sarah Cannon Research Institute (SCRI) is one of the world’s leading oncology research organizations conducting community-based clinical trials.
Research Nurse for Blood Cancer and Bone Marrow Transplant position at Sarah Cannon Research Institute (SCRI) involves screening, enrolling, and following study subjects, ensuring protocol compliance and monitoring adverse events. The role requires an Associate Degree; preferably a Bachelor’s Degree, RN License, and at least one year of oncology experience. The position involves working with patients, physicians, and clinical trial procedures.
